Canal-top PV for Afghanistan’s massive irrigation project

A team of scientists has simulated covering 20% of the Qush-Tepa irrigation canal with PV panels. To this end, the researchers developed a framework, termed an integrated techno-economic-environmental assessment, that can be applied elsewhere. “It explicitly quantifies energy production, water-evaporation reduction, land-use savings, and economic performance within a single analytical structure,” one of the researchers said.

Researchers achieve record perovskite solar module stability under light, heat, and UV stress

An international research team has developed a new two-dimensional perovskite interlayer based on a co-crystal engineering strategy for more robust perovskite films. It demonstrated improved performance in small area perovskite solar cells and, in a 48 cm2 module, contributed to retain 95% of initial efficiency after 5,000 h.

China extends anti-dumping duties on solar-grade silicon from US, South Korea

The duties range from 53.3% to 57% for U.S. producers and from 2.4% to 48.7% for South Korean companies and will remain in force for a further five years.

Tongwei unveils 770 W TOPCon PV module with 24.8% efficiency

The Chinese manufacturer unveiled its new TOPCon bifacial TNC3.0 module at WFES 2025. The 1,500 V, IP68-rated panel offers over 85% bifaciality, a 0.26%/C temperature coefficient, and a 30-year warranty guaranteeing 88.85% output.
